In this episode, Jacob Skoda '25 shares his journey from serving in the Air Force to pursuing a law degree, driven by a passion for advocating on behalf of veterans. He explains why it's so important to fight for veterans' rights and secure the benefits they deserve.

With Veterans Day approaching, Jacob also highlights the upcoming Veterans Law Day at Albany Law School, a free event presented by the Edward P. Swyer Justice Center at Albany Law School’s Veterans' Pro Bono Project. The event offers one-on-one legal consultations for veterans, active service members, and their families, with expanded resources from the McNulty Veteran Business Center and The Legal Project.
